Dress for Success




There’s an old saying in business – you should dress for success. What that means is that you should dress the way you want to be perceived. If you want to be the boss, dress like the boss. If you want to the be the sloppy frazzled one, dress to suit. Of course, we’re not at work yet, but the same rules apply. You should always dress the way you want to appear to others.

I don’t just mean fashions. I mean you should dress the way you want others to think of you. Your grandmother is the best judge of this in the world. If she’s ever told you that so-and-so looks like a hood, or thug, or criminal – he might be the nicest guy in the world, but he’ll likely be thought of that way by a large portion of people in your grandmother’s generation at least.

Obviously your grandmother isn’t the best judge of style and current fashions and she might be prejudiced, but always remember not every fashion is right for you. Clothes you’d wear to a party of the beach are not suitable for school or church. Well, not usually – I guess it depends on your school or church.

Nobody likes to be judged, especially not by their appearance, but unfortunately, these things do happen. Dress the way you feel most comfortable, but always think about how you appear to others and how you can use that image to help yourself. The way you feel in your clothes and the choices you actually make in life are much more important than what strangers might think of you on the street.

Prepare Your Wardrobe for Summer



It’s almost summer and the hot weather is making us ready for swimsuits and shorts. As the sun heats up, the heavy winter clothing can be put away. Of course, you’ll need to hang on to a sweatshirt to keep from freezing in the air conditioned school these last few days, but other than that, shove the winter clothes into the back of the closet and dig out your favorite shorts and halters. It’s summertime!

Getting Ready
You might not be heading to the beach or pool yet, but that’s no reason you shouldn’t be ready for that first pool party invite. Pull out all of your clothes and play dress up games in the mirror. See what fits from last year and what outfits are still in style and which can go. If you need help pulling together the latest styles, online dress up games can help.

Filling The Gaps
Once you’ve assessed what’s already in your closet, you need to fill in the gaps. Head to the stores with the intention of grabbing a few trendy pieces, like madras shorts, as well as any basics you might have outgrown from last year such as tanks and halters. Of course, you’ll need a terrific bathing suit as well.

Organize
Finally, organize your new summer wardrobe so that you can reach a terrific outfit in minutes. That way, you’ll always be ready to go for whatever exciting opportunity comes along.
